How to add member in costco

To add a member at Costco, you need to visit the membership counter at your local Costco warehouse or go online to their official website.
You can also call their customer service if you prefer assistance over the phone.
To add someone to your membership, you’ll need to provide some basic information and identification.
If you’re doing it online, simply log into your account and follow the prompts to add a new member.
Costco allows you to add one additional household member to your membership.
This could be a spouse, partner, or anyone living at the same address.
When you visit in person, make sure to bring your current membership card and a valid ID for the new member.
If you want to add more than one member, you’ll need to get a separate membership for each additional person.
Remember, there might be a small fee associated with adding new members if they don’t have their own membership already.
It’s a straightforward process, and the staff at Costco are usually quite helpful.
If you’re using the website, you’ll find the option under your account settings.
Just follow the instructions, and you’ll have your new member added in no time.
